Big win for SA's rooibos tea market
The Department of Trade, Industry, and Competition announced on Tuesday, 9 January 2024, that the Chinese government has decided to slash tariffs on rooibos tea to 6%, down from its previous range of between 15% and 30%. 10 Jan 2024

Firms are going cashless, and that’s okay: Reserve Bank
Retailers are not obliged to accept cash as a means of payment, even though it is defined as legal tender. 9 Jan 2024
WCafes are going cashless, not Woolworths supermarkets
An image shared on social media recently led many to believe that Woolworths would no longer be accepting cash, which of course caused a social media storm. However, Woolworths confirmed via social media that this only applies to its WCafé stores, and not the supermarket as many believed. 8 Jan 2024
